Punjab man killed in Bengaluru

Hoshiarpur (Pb): A 35-year-old man, who was aspiring to go abroad, was allegedly killed by his travel agents in Bengaluru, police said today.

Surinder Pal, a resident Kalyanpur village here, wanted to go to Canada and had got in touch with the agents, Superintendent of Police (SP), Investigation, Harpreet Singh said.


Harminder Singh alias Shelly, G D Patel, Sanjeev and Naresh, who claimed to be agents, had promised to send him to Canada, the SP said.

They instead took him to Bengaluru and allegedly killed him there about two months ago, Harpreet said.

The accused have been booked under relevant sections of the Indian Penal Code, follwoing a complaint by Pal's relative Gobind Singh.

Gobind suspected that Pal was in the illegal custody of the travel agents in Bengaluru and lodged the complaint, the officer said.

Harpreet said that when a police party went to get him freed from the alleged captivity in Bengaluru, they were told that his body was recovered from the bushes of a village there on December 6.

In Benagaluru, officials concerned cremated the body tagging it unidentified and unclaimed, he said.

Pal is survived by his wife, three-year-old daughter and two-month-old son. He was also looking after his widow sister and her two children, family members said.  PTI
